Just wanted to let you all know that the final agenda has been adjusted a
bit, so please revisit the site and check it out.
http://www.sqlsaturday.com/22/schedule.aspx

New to our already fantastic line-up is Kevin Kline, presenting on "SQL
Server Internals and Architecture" and during the lunchtime slot, he'll be
presenting on "Understanding and Preventing SQL Injection Attacks",
teaching you how to keep your servers and your data secure from hackers.

Also, if you haven't noticed, we have a special early bird session going
on in the auditorium at 7:30.  We are honored to have Steve Jones of SQL
Server Central presenting a beginners session on "Basic SQL Server".  This
session will cover what SQL does, basic objects and queries, indexes, and
security.  Great chance to get some concrete understanding on how SQL
really works, even if you don't know anything about SQL!  We will be sure
to have the coffee and donuts there early!
